The Egyptian Railway Authority has announced the commencement of 110 daily train services on the Cairo-Alexandria line, a move designed to enhance transportation services between Egypt's two largest cities. This decision reflects the authority's commitment to improving service levels and meeting the needs of citizens.
The new services will cover all times of the day, providing multiple options for travelers. It has also been confirmed that these trains will operate around the clock, facilitating movement between the two cities and bolstering trade and tourism.
Details of the Service
The trains will be scheduled throughout the day, starting with early morning departures and continuing until late at night. This time distribution allows travelers to choose a convenient time, whether for business trips or tourism.
The authority has also confirmed that it has improved service quality on board the trains, updating carriages and providing additional services for passengers, ensuring a comfortable and safe travel experience.
